My written statement
It seem a little odd, but I have always loved paper.
As a child I would sit, scissors in hand and cut-out chains of people & free snowflakes from sheets of paper just to entertain myself.
When I started a 365 photography project back in 2011 it didn't take long to run out of things to photograph. Once again I turned to a blank sheet of white paper; this time to make something to use as a prop.
2458 days later I'm still taking a photograph everyday. Making stuff from paper has become my “thing” and with my camera I try to bring my imagination to each paper scene.
This panel of 20 images comes from my on-going photography project and represents a glimpse of how I imagine the night would look if the world was made of paper.
